## Log
+### 2021-02-02
+
+Mituo Heijo has fuzzed xz and found a bug in the function readIndexBody. The
+function allocated a slice of records immediately after reading the value
+without further checks. Since the number has been too large the make function
+did panic. The fix is to check the number against the expected number of records
+before allocating the records.
